[Trac] Re: Trac performance optimization

2008-01-15 Thread C. Daniel Chase
PS... I forgot to add that the command 'staticcopy' was changed to *copystatic* in r6396, so I had a little difficulty at first before checking out the latest changeset. :-) So, I'm confirming this is function on 0.11dev-6396 specifically. -Dan -- C. Daniel Chase
